7th Grade AP History typically focuses on world history from early civilizations through the modern era, emphasizing historical analysis, primary source interpretation, and thematic connections across time periods. Students learn to think like historians by examining cause-and-effect relationships, comparing societies, and understanding how past events shape our world today. The course builds critical thinking skills that prepare students for advanced history study and standardized assessments.

Many 7th graders struggle with managing the volume of information—memorizing dates, names, and events while also understanding broader historical themes and connections. Another common challenge is developing strong analytical writing skills, as AP-level history requires students to support arguments with evidence from primary and secondary sources. Time management during exams and organizing complex information into coherent essays are also frequent pain points for students new to AP-level rigor.

Strong AP History essays require a clear thesis, organized body paragraphs with specific evidence, and analysis that explains why your examples matter. Tutors can help you practice structuring arguments, selecting relevant primary and secondary sources to support your points, and revising drafts for clarity and depth. Regular practice with timed writing and feedback on your work builds the skills and confidence needed to write compelling historical arguments.

Effective strategies include creating thematic timelines that show how different civilizations and events connect, using spaced repetition to review key concepts over time, and practicing retrieval by testing yourself on material rather than just re-reading notes. Tutors can teach you how to organize information by historical themes—like trade, warfare, or cultural exchange—rather than just memorizing isolated facts, which helps your brain make meaningful connections. Active practice, like writing practice essays and discussing historical arguments, is far more effective for long-term retention than passive studying.
